Our fifteen student equipment managers showed up for work today at 9am. Today is officially their first day of the season. It appears that we have a GREAT group of managers. We return a bunch of great kids, and we were fortunate that we had a great group of kids that approached us about becoming a manager.

At sharply 9am, they had to endure my 1 hour sermon on what I expect of them. I covered everything from A to Z. I know they hate hearing it all, especially the veterans, but I enjoy doing it, and it is something that has to be done.

We have a great breakdown of younger and older, and from all over the country. We have 4 from Chicago IL area, 4 from California (3 Bay Area and 1 Sacramento), 1 from New York City, 1 from Orlando Florida, 1 from West Lafayette Indiana, 1 from El Paso Texas, 1 from Idaho/Ohio, and 2 from Arizona (1 Tucson and 1 Scottsdale).

After the sermon, they went right into this years draft. This is not only one of the most important things we do, they have alot of fun doing it. This is where the managers choose what players they will be doing Helmet and Shoulder Pad maintenance on, in addition to other responsiblities they will have for their players.
